Over-running engineering works have caused disruption for commuters travelling by train on Monday morning.

Works on tracks near Rutherglen have caused delays for trains between Glasgow and Shotts, Falkirk Grahamston and Lanark.

The disruption is expected to continue until around 10am Monday morning.

ScotRail apologised for the delays and said tickets would be accepted on First buses.

The engineering work at Rutherglen is to improve tracks and signalling.

Network Rail, which maintains railway lines, had earlier said services would be impacted on Monday "because of the scale of work required."

It said in a Tweet: "More than 500 trains per day run through where we need to work so there is no ideal time to do this without some inconvenience."
